Lady Cat Soccer Defeats Ohio Valley For First Win

09/14/2011

The Lady Cat soccer team got goals from Lisa Mix (Framingham, MA) and Jackie Becerra (Saddle Brook, NJ) to build a 2-1 halftime lead, before adding three more in the second half to secure a 5-1 win at Ohio Valley (WV) University in Wednesday's WVIAC opener. Pitt-Johnstown picked-up its first win of the year and improved to 1-4-0 overall and 1-0-0 in conference-play.
Mix opened the scoring off of Becerra's assist 52 seconds into the match. Two minutes later, Mix assisted on Becerra's goal to make it 2-0.
Ohio Valley answered in the 21st minute when Amanda Simpson found the back of the net behind Lady Cat goalkeeper Timi Shiock (Punxsutawney, Pa.).
The score remained the same until the 63rd minute. That's when Pitt-Johnstown put it away with goals by Kelsey Richardson (Scottdale, Pa.), Elizabeth Steffen (Halifax, Pa.), and Emily Brady (Donegal, Pa.) over the final 28 minutes to set the final at 5-1.
Shiock played the first 48 minutes in goal to earn her first collegiate victory. Shiock allowed one goal and made one save. Victoria Der Vanik (Bridgeville, Pa.) played the final 42 minutes in net and didn't have to make a save.
With the loss, Ohio Valley fell to 0-3-0 overall and 0-1-0 in the WVIAC.
The Lady Cats travel to Concord (WV) University for a WVIAC match on Saturday, before hosting a conference match against West Virginia Wesleyan College as part of a WVIAC doubleheader with the Mountain Cats. Kick-off for the women's match is set for 2 p.m., followed by the men's game at 4 p.m. at the Pitt-Johnstown Soccer Field.
